Handover: Rhea to Callum, for the eng sync. I got about 60% through untangling the old Pondwright ORM layer — the lazy-loading hacks in the invoice models are gone, and the session factory is finally sane. Still left: the cursed many-to-many joins in the shipments module (sorry). Branch is orm-rework-phase2, tests mostly green. Heads up: the migration sandbox locked itself after my last run, so you'll need to recover it before touching anything. The recovery passphrase is right below — guard it.

unlock words, yagag-yahog: gordor-zorvan-druius-queniel-normir-norwyn-framir-novmir-ralius-holwyn-wenwyn-tamael-silok-holdor

Keyturn, our internal secrets-rotation utility, reads all runtime settings from a `.env` file located in the project root. Please do not commit this file; it is already listed in `.gitignore`. Defaults in `env.sample` cover the rotation schedule, retry windows, and the Ashvale staging endpoints, and you should leave those untouched unless directed otherwise. The one value you must provide yourself is the bootstrap credential that authorizes Keyturn against the Dunmoor vault cluster. Open your `.env` file and add the following line:

sealed setting: VAULT_KEY20=c8ea1e419912889df6b4

Meeting notes — Lumivault sync, Tuesday. We reviewed the rounding discrepancies in the Kestrelpay conversion module: totals drift by up to two minor units when converting through the intermediate ledger currency. Support should tag affected tickets as "rounding-drift" and avoid promising exact refunds until the banker's-rounding patch ships. All rounding escalations should go directly to the owner named below.

named custodian: Brivan Eliath Quenox Frador